반응형

Ajax 21

$.get of jquery는 비동기식입니까?

$.get of jquery는 비동기식입니까? 저는 제 웹사이트에서 비동기식 통화를 사용해야 하는지 고민했습니다.사용해야 할 내용을 명시적으로 지정할 수 있습니다. $.ajax 하지만 처음에는 사용을 시도했습니다.$.get그리고 서버가 많은 정보를 반환해야 했지만 브라우저가 움직이지 않았고 문제없이 탐색할 수 있었습니다. 인터넷으로 조금 검색해봤지만, 아직도 둘의 차이를 100% 확신할 수는 없습니다. 한다면$.get비동기적인 이유는 무엇일까요?$.ajax? 만약 그렇지 않다면, 제가 어떻게 내비게이션에 문제가 없었는지 다시 한번 확인해 보십시오.$.get, 무슨 소용이 있습니까?$.ajax? 미리 감사드립니다예, 비동기식입니다.설명서에서: 이것은 Ajax의 축약 함수로, 다음과 같습니다. $.ajax(..

source 2023.11.05

ASP에서 장시간 실행 중인 서버 호출의 진행률 표시줄.순 MVC

ASP에서 장시간 실행 중인 서버 호출의 진행률 표시줄.순 MVC 문 닫았습니다.이 질문은 필요합니다.디버깅 세부 정보입니다.현재 답변을 받지 않고 있습니다. 원하는 동작, 특정 문제 또는 오류, 문제를 재현하는 데 필요한 최단 코드를 포함하도록 질문을 편집합니다.이렇게 하면 다른 사람들이 질문에 답하는 데 도움이 될 것입니다. 4년전에 문을 닫았습니다. 이 질문을 개선합니다. 서버 호출을 오래 실행하면서 프로그레스 바를 만들고 싶습니다.컨트롤러가 긴 실행 작업을 수행하는 동안 컨트롤러에 ajax post 요청을 생성할 수 없습니다. 현재 장기 실행 중인 작업의 실제 설명을 얻기 위해 추가 작업을 만들고 싶습니다.ajax request에서 poll을 작성하려고 하면 서버측에서 상태를 반환하여 클라이언트측..

source 2023.10.16

CSS를 동적으로 로드하는 중

CSS를 동적으로 로드하는 중 제 사이트의 페이지 테마 기능을 만들려고 합니다.별도의 CSS 파일을 이용하여 해당 테마를 페이지에 동적으로 로드하고 싶습니다. 이 코드를 사용하고 있습니다. fileref.setAttribute("rel", "stylesheet") fileref.setAttribute("type", "text/css") fileref.setAttribute("href", 'link.css') document.getElementsByTagName("head")[0].appendChild(fileref) 이것은 잘 작동하지만 CSS 파일이 로드되었는지 여부에 따라 어떠한 정보도 반환하지 않습니다. 그 때 잡을 방법이 있나요?.css로딩되었습니까?아약스를 이용해서?Internet Explore..

source 2023.10.11

바이트 배열을 이미지로 변환하는 방법?

바이트 배열을 이미지로 변환하는 방법? 자바스크립트를 이용해서 WCF 서비스로 AJAX 호출을 하는데 바이트 배열을 돌려주고 있습니다.그것을 이미지로 변환해서 웹 페이지에 표시하려면 어떻게 해야 합니까?오래된 쓰레드라는 것을 알지만 웹 서비스에서 AJAX의 호출을 통해 이 작업을 수행할 수 있었고 공유할 생각이 있었습니다. 내 페이지에 이미 이미지가 있습니다. AJAX: $.ajax({ type: 'POST', contentType: 'application/json; charset=utf-8', dataType: 'json', timeout: 10000, url: 'Common.asmx/GetItemPreview', data: '{"id":"' + document.getElementById("AwardD..

source 2023.09.16

ajax 문제 - firebug에서는 200 OK이지만 응답 본문이 없는 빨간색

ajax 문제 - firebug에서는 200 OK이지만 응답 본문이 없는 빨간색 크로스 도메인과 관련된 작은 아약스 문제가 있습니다. 로컬 컴퓨터에서 일부 아약스를 사용하여 html 예제를 만들었습니다. 등록 텍스트 필드 사용자가 'username'을 입력하면 모든 키 입력 아약스에서 로컬 Tomcat으로 보내며, 서블릿은 해당 사용자 이름이 이미 사용되고 있는지 확인하고 'taken' 응답을 다시 보냅니다. 로컬 호스트에서는 전혀 문제가 없습니다.사용한 'username' 서블릿을 입력하면 'taken' 응답이 전송되고 브라우저에 표시됩니다. 그러나 로컬 호스트 Tomcat에서 유효성 검사 요청을 보내는 원격 컴퓨터(원격 네트워크에서 일부 무료 호스팅)에 ajax가 있는 test html 페이지를 놓으..

source 2023.09.06

JSON 개체를 ASP로 전송했습니다.NET WebMethod, jQuery 사용

JSON 개체를 ASP로 전송했습니다.NET WebMethod, jQuery 사용 저는 이 일을 3시간 동안 하고 포기했습니다.나는 단지 ASP에 데이터를 보내려고 합니다.JQuery를 사용하는 NET 웹 메서드입니다.데이터는 기본적으로 키/값 쌍의 집합입니다.그래서 저는 배열을 만들고 그 배열에 쌍을 추가하려고 했습니다. 내 웹 메서드(aspx.cs )는 다음과 같습니다(JavaScript에서 빌드하고 있는 것에 대해 잘못되었을 수도 있습니다, 저는 잘 모르겠습니다. [WebMethod] public static string SaveRecord(List items) { ... } 다음은 제 샘플 JavaScript입니다. var items = new Array; var data1 = { compId: ..

source 2023.09.01

Spring MVC의 Ajax 요청에서 세션 시간 초과 탐지

Spring MVC의 Ajax 요청에서 세션 시간 초과 탐지 세션이 시간 초과되었을 때 Ajax 요청에서 일부 데이터를 다시 보내는 방법에 대한 좋은 예/답변을 찾을 수 없습니다.그것은 로그인 페이지 HTML을 다시 보내고 나는 json을 보내거나 내가 가로챌 수 있는 코드를 보내고 싶습니다.가장 간단한 방법은 AJAX 요청의 URL에 필터를 사용하는 것입니다. 아래 예제에서는 세션 시간 초과를 나타내는 응답 본문과 함께 HTTP 500 응답 코드를 보내고 있지만, 응답 코드와 본문을 사용자의 경우에 더 적합한 것으로 쉽게 설정할 수 있습니다. package com.myapp.security.authentication; import org.springframework.web.filter.GenericFi..

source 2023.08.27

Ajax 내부의 Javascript 변수에 액세스 성공

Ajax 내부의 Javascript 변수에 액세스 성공 var flag = false; //True if checkbox is checked $.ajax({ ... //type, url, beforeSend, I'm not able to access flag here success: function(){ // I'm not able to access flag here } }); Ajax 내부에서, 만약 내가 접속을 시도한다면.flag정의되지 않았다고 합니다.아약스 함수 안에서 어떻게 사용할 수 있습니까? 감 잡히는 게 없어요? 플래그와 아약스는 모두 함수의 본문입니다.이 함수에는 다른 항목이 없습니다.참조를 통해 변수를 만들면 변수에 액세스할 수 있습니다.Javascript의 모든 개체는 참조된 값이지만..

source 2023.08.27

X-Requested-With 헤더 서버 검사가 Ajax 기반 애플리케이션의 CSRF로부터 보호하기에 충분합니까?

X-Requested-With 헤더 서버 검사가 Ajax 기반 애플리케이션의 CSRF로부터 보호하기에 충분합니까? 저는 모든 요청이 기본적으로 기본적으로 다음과 같이 보이는 메인 컨트롤러를 통과하는 완전히 Ajax 기반의 애플리케이션을 개발하고 있습니다. if(strtolower($_SERVER['HTTP_X_REQUESTED_WITH']) == 'xmlhttprequest') { fetch($page); } 이 정도면 일반적으로 사이트 간 요청 위조로부터 보호하기에 충분합니까? 요청할 때마다 전체 페이지가 새로 고쳐지지 않을 때는 회전 토큰이 있는 것이 불편합니다. 저는 모든 요청에 따라 고유 토큰을 글로벌 자바스크립트 변수로 전달하고 업데이트할 수 있다고 생각합니다. 하지만 왠지 어색하고 본질적으로 ..

source 2023.08.17

JSONP 요청 반환 오류: "Uncaught SyntaxError:예기치 않은 토큰 :"

JSONP 요청 반환 오류: "Uncaught SyntaxError:예기치 않은 토큰 :" 그래서 다음과 같은 jQuery 코드로 Stack Exchange API에 요청하려고 합니다. $.ajax({ type: 'POST', url: 'http://api.stackoverflow.com/1.1/stats', dataType: 'jsonp', success: function() { console.log('Success!'); }, error: function() { console.log('Uh Oh!'); } }); 그러나 FireFox 또는 Chrome 컴퓨터에서 파일을 열고 요청을 하면 다음 오류가 발생합니다. Resource interpreted as Script but transferred wit..

source 2023.08.07
반응형